Whitewater Ski Resort

9.0/10 (180 reviews)
This powder paradise in British Columbia receives an astounding 40 feet of annual snowfall. Explore untouched glades and challenging bowls while enjoying the uncrowded, authentic mountain experience.

Kokanee Creek Provincial Park

9.4/10 (225 reviews)
Witness the mesmerizing spectacle of kokanee salmon returning to spawn in this lakeside provincial park. Hike through cedar forests, relax on sandy beaches, or join educational programs at the nature center.

Cottonwood Falls Park

9.0/10 (55 reviews)
This serene park features a picturesque waterfall and Japanese Friendship Garden symbolizing Nelson's bond with Izu-shi, Japan. Visit summer Saturdays for the vibrant local farmers' market.

Lakeside Park

9.2/10 (457 reviews)
Lakeside Park offers a stunning waterfront escape along Kootenay Lake with a sandy beach and lush gardens. Ride the historic Streetcar #23 in summer while enjoying panoramic views of Nelson's iconic orange bridge.

Touchstones Museum

9.0/10 (41 reviews)
Housed in a restored 1902 heritage building, this museum showcases Nelson and Kootenay's rich cultural tapestry through rotating art exhibitions and historical artifacts. Support local artisans at the museum shop.

Shopping

In Nelson, visit the local shops along Baker Street for un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, check out the West Kootenay Mall in nearby Castlegar, offering a variety of retail options, or stop by the Trail Market for local crafts and artisan goods.

Recreation

Cottonwood Falls Park offers serene walking trails and soothing waterfalls, perfect for relaxation and nature connection. At Granite Pointe Golf Club, enjoy a round of golf surrounded by stunning vistas, while Balfour Golf Course, located 18 miles away, provides a scenic outdoor experience for sports enthusiasts.

Adventure

Experience thrilling winter sports at Whitewater Ski Resort, where powdery slopes await. Hike Pulpit Rock for breathtaking scenery and outdoor adventure. For climbing enthusiasts, The Cube Climbing Centre offers exciting routes that challenge your skills in a vibrant, sporty atmosphere.

Nightlife

In Nelson, British Columbia, enjoy a vibrant nightlife at venues like The Royal, known for its live music, and the Hume Hotel's Lounge, perfect for a cozy drink. Explore Baker Street for eclectic bars and casual eateries, where you can soak up the local atmosphere and meet new friends.

Best time to go to Nelson

The best time to visit Nelson can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Nelson fal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Nelson falls in December,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January22.3°F (-5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February23.2°F (-4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
March30.9°F (-0.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April39.0°F (3.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ly Low
May50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July66.4°F (19.1°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August66.0°F (18.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September55.6°F (13.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
October41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November29.5°F (-1.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December21.0°F (-6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
